1. Top Speed

The maximum speed of a fold-away treadmill under desk is an important aspect to consider. The majority are restricted to less than 5 mph, which means walking on these devices will feel more like leisurely strolling rather than a sweat-inducing workout. This may not be a problem for some individuals, but if you're seeking to experience a powerful cardio burst in between Zoom meetings, this kind of device isn't the best choice for you.

2. Noise

While treadmills under desks are excellent for enhancing movement at work and providing a health benefit however, they also generate lots of noise. Certain models are quieter. If you intend to use your treadmill under desk in a shared space, it is important to consider how much noise the machine can create. In addition, the kind of flooring that you put underneath your treadmill will impact the amount of noise it generates. For instance, floors made of wood tend to amplify the sound and may cause it to be annoying to other workers in the area.

The speed at the speed at which the treadmill desk is used will determine the volume at which it sounds. For example, if you run at a high speed, the noise level may be similar to a toilet flushing or vacuuming. However, the sound will decrease as you lower the speed.

The majority of treadmills under desks are motorized, and a few models have an integrated desktop which helps keep noise levels low. Certain treadmills have an acoustic cushion that is placed under the belt that reduces the noise.

4. Size

Although they have a limited maximum speed and don't come with handlebars, under desk treadmills are an excellent option for people who are looking to do some light walking while at home. They are also useful for those with back pain or mobility issues. They are often cheaper than gym memberships and can provide similar health benefits.

When they are not in use, they can be stored under the desk or in a quiet corner of the room. This is particularly useful for those who live in cramped areas or who have young children or pets. Some have apps that lets you connect to your machine and keep track of your fitness and wellness goals.

One under-desk treadmill we love is the UREVO 2-in-1. Although it's not the most powerful model, at under $370 on Amazon, it's an affordable choice for people who want to stay within their budget and still get a workout in during their workday. The model folds to itself and is easy to store when not in use.

WalkingPad P1 is another good alternative. This machine folds completely in half and can be tucked into the desk or against the wall. It has the option of a remote control as well as an LED display that helps you monitor your performance and set goals. It's a bit heavier than other models we tested at 62 pounds. However, it has wheels at the bottom, so you can easily move it around.

The 180 degree folding design makes it easy to place under your desk, sofa or your bed. Its lightweight weight and 180-degree folding design makes it easy to store. It has a heavy-weight limit and a fashionable digital display that displays your distance, steps as well as calories burned and other information.
